Bill O’Reilly helps raise cash in Palm Beach for rape victims’ advocates

O'Reilly addresses fans Friday night at Mar-a-Lago (Click on the Mike Price photo for more on the event)
Fox News superstar Bill O’Reilly, the non-nonsense host of the top-rated The O’Reilly Factor, preached to the converted Friday night at Palm Beach’s Mar-a-Lago.
In his “State of the Union” talk, the conservative host blasted liberal rival MSNBC, calling it “little” because “eight people watch it.”
Comparing the White House to the Chicago mob, O’Reilly said he hopes for low approval ratings for Pres. Barack Obama because, when that happens, The Factor’s ratings go up.
And he predicted that Republican Mitt Romney would take on Obama in the 2012 presidential elections, with Sarah Palin’s third party candidate siphoning votes from Obama.
But O’Reilly, 60, didn’t really come to talk politics. He came to help shine the limelight on a newbie on Palm Beach’s charity landscape: the It Happened to Alexa Foundation. And it worked. About 400 people paid up to $600 for a photo with O’Reilly, his speech and a steak dinner.
